Join Tiffany & Co. in São Paulo as an Operations Coordinator. Leverage your expertise in inventory management and customer service in a prestigious luxury environment.

Overview

Tiffany & Co., a distinguished name in the luxury jewelry sector, operates under the umbrella of LVMH, a global leader in luxury goods. Renowned for its exquisite craftsmanship and timeless elegance, Tiffany & Co. offers a dynamic and prestigious work environment where innovation meets tradition.

Role & Responsibilities

  • Oversee inventory management, ensuring accuracy and compliance with corporate standards.
  • Coordinate security team operations and manage inventory cycles and full counts.
  • Collaborate with store management and sales teams to enhance sales and profitability.
  • Ensure adherence to company policies, including jewelry presentation security protocols.
  • Report directly to the Store Director/Manager and Head of Operations at the corporate level.

Qualifications

  • Minimum of 5 years of experience in customer service and/or operations.
  • Proficiency in English sufficient for business conversations and reading comprehension.
  • Degree in Business Administration or Industrial Engineering, preferably with an accounting focus.

Skills

Strong numerical and analytical abilities. Excellent oral and written communication skills. Problem-solving aptitude. Flexibility to work a 6-day work week schedule. Proficiency in Microsoft Office. Ability to inspire trust, integrity, and professionalism among clients and team members.
